Hybrid Data Scientist & ML/AI Engineer
London, England, United Kingdom
Full Time Mid-level / Intermediate GBP 45K - 75K
Mumsnet
Mumsnet makes parents’ lives easier by pooling knowledge, advice and support on everything from conception to childbirth, from babies to teenagers.The role
We are looking for a talented Data Scientist / Machine Learning Engineer to join our dynamic data team at Mumsnet. You will play a key role in building data-driven products and leveraging AI/LLM technologies to enhance our platform and user experience. Your work will have a direct impact on our 9 million users, driving innovation through machine learning and data analytics.
You will be responsible for designing, developing, and deploying machine learning models, as well as integrating AI-driven solutions via APIs. Strong communication skills are essential, as you will collaborate with teams across product, engineering, and commercial to translate their requirements into actual data products. We have successfully built our very own AI platform, MumsGPT, which is a combination of AI-agents that bring together and analyse all Mumsnet’s qualitative and quantitative data in a super efficient and user friendly way. In this role, you will be responsible for maintaining and improving the platform as well as building new ML/AI driven data products.
This is a fantastic opportunity to be part of an exciting, growing team that is shaping the future of Mumsnet with cutting-edge data science and AI solutions.
What you’ll be doing
Every day in the Mumsnet data team is different. We work with web traffic, textual data, and large datasets to develop new data products and AI-powered features. Your responsibilities will include:
- Machine Learning & AI Development:
- Designing, training, and deploying machine learning models for predictive analytics, personalization, and automation, with a particular focus on NLP applications.
- Leveraging AI/LLMs (e.g., GPT, Gemini, LLaMA) for content moderation, entity extraction, analysing and summarising huge amounts of text data, and other business needs.
- Data Product Development:
- Building and maintaining scalable data products, pipelines, and REST APIs.
- Implementing ML models in production, ensuring performance, monitoring, and scalability.
- Data Engineering & Analytics:
- Working with ingestion and processing of structured and unstructured data from multiple sources.
- Collaborating with team members to optimize data infrastructure and ETL workflows.
- Stakeholder Collaboration & Communication:
- Partnering with the product team to implement data-driven features.
- Presenting insights and recommendations to both technical and non-technical stakeholders.
- Documenting and sharing best practices for AI/ML model development.
Why work for us?
We focus on steady, sustainable growth, putting purpose (to make parent’s lives easier) before profit. We expect great performance, agility and collaboration in every role; cross-team working with talented, clever people is the best part of life at Mumsnet. Most importantly we’re looking for candidates with a growth mindset - we know everyone makes mistakes, the important thing is to learn from them and to share your learnings.
We embraced flexible and home working a long time before COVID, and we care much more about outputs than hours on the clock. We don't only want to hire the best people: we want to retain them. If you need some flexibility, let us know and we’ll do our best.
We’re committed to diversity and quality (see our policy ) and we think we’re second to none in the all-round support we offer to parents and carers at work (see our parental leave policies ). Working for Mumsnet means never having to pretend you don’t have a family or other commitments, and we promise never to keep you away from a school appointment. We are also proud to be a London Living Wage employer and we have never used unpaid interns.
We have a healthy line-up of sandwich lunches, knowledge sessions, book clubs, yoga sessions, monthly socials and sports teams, as well as an unhealthy line-up of staff parties at Kentish Town’s excellent pubs and restaurants, and McDonald’s deliveries for the mornings after.
WFH
We’ve continued to embrace flexibility and remote working to the max. You’ll only be required to be in the office two days a week (although you can go in more often if you wish). We’re flexible with hours and happy to accommodate personal commitments like picking the kids up from school. We’re more interested in output than presenteeism, so if you need to move things around, we can probably work it out.
How we'll support you
- Weekly or bi-weekly 1-1 with line manager to review progress, agree roles, provide support;
- Formal 6-month appraisal system;
- Buddy and Mentor Programmes;
- LinkedIn online learning - bi-weekly DEAL(Drop Everything And Learn) sessions, training to be agreed with your line manager;
- Ongoing on the job training from your line manager.
This role sits within our data team and reports into the Chief Data Officer and is based at our offices in Kentish Town. This role is envisaged as full-time but we are happy to consider flexible options for the right candidate.
If all of this sounds good to you, please apply with your CV and a covering letter that demonstrates some of the qualities we’re looking for.
Requirements
- Technical Skills:
- Strong proficiency in Python and relevant frameworks/libraries (NumPy, Pandas, Scikit-Learn, TensorFlow/PyTorch, LangChain, LangGraph, Hugging Face, etc.).
- Experience working with LLMs and AI models in production environments.
- Experience building RAG-based applications and vector databases
- Experience with graph databases like Neo4J or Memgraph
- Hands-on experience with SQL and cloud platforms (GCP, AWS, or Azure).
- Experience building APIs for AI/ML models using FastAPI, Flask, or similar frameworks.
- Proficiency in data visualization tools (Looker, Streamlit, Plotly, matplotlib, etc.).
- Knowledge of MLOps best practices for deployment, monitoring, and model lifecycle management.
- Knowledge of general CI/CD best practices
- Experience with Docker for containerisation and deployment
- Soft Skills:
- Strong analytical mindset and problem-solving abilities.
- Ability to communicate complex data concepts to non-technical audiences.
- Passion for learning new AI/ML technologies and applying them in real-world applications.
- Nice to Have:
- Exposure to A/B testing and experimental design.
- Familiarity with Reinforcement Learning with Human Feedback (RLHF).
Benefits
We’re pleased to offer the following benefits, subject to eligibility:
- Salary range between £45,000-£75,000 depending on expertise and experience
- 25 Days Holiday
- Buy More Holiday Scheme
- Cycle2Work Scheme
- Employee Assistance Programme
- Mumsnet Workplace Pension Scheme
- Electric Vehicle Scheme
- LinkedIn Learning Subscription with fortnightly “Drop Everything And Learn” time
- Leisure and Retail perks discounts through the Perkbox platform
- BUPA Private Medical cover
- Wellness benefits including daily workouts and meditations via Perkbox
- Monthly team social events
- Annual team bonus opportunities .
Want to know more?
Check out - our guide to what it's like to work at Mumsnet. Read about our mission, our vision, our values and the behaviours we expect of the people who work at Mumsnet.
Tags: A/B testing APIs AWS Azure CI/CD Data Analytics Data visualization Docker Engineering ETL FastAPI Flask GCP Gemini GPT LangChain LLaMA LLMs Looker Machine Learning Matplotlib ML models MLOps Neo4j NLP NumPy Pandas Pipelines Plotly Python PyTorch RAG Reinforcement Learning RLHF Scikit-learn SQL Streamlit TensorFlow Testing Unstructured data
Perks/benefits: Career development Equity / stock options Flex hours Lunch / meals Medical leave Parental leave Salary bonus Team events Yoga
More jobs like this
Explore more career opportunities
Find even more open roles below ordered by popularity of job title or skills/products/technologies used.